If you’re anything like us here at Cosmo, you’re a fan of an enemies-to-lovers plotline.
If this is your beat, allow us to recommend How To Break My Heart, the new novel by Sydney author Kat T. Masen. The tale follows a small-town café owner living in the fictional town of Cinnamon Springs, and her best friend’s billionaire brother, who are forced to work together to plan a wedding.
Before you pick up a copy for yourself, meet protagonists Eva and Aston, and get a taste of their complicated (but undeniably steamy) dynamic below.
Warning: Spoilers for How To Break My Heart by Kat T. Masen ahead.

How To Break My Heart by Kat T. Masen

“Eva Woods is perfectly content with her quiet life in the picturesque town of Cinnamon Springs where she owns a café infamous for its mouthwatering donuts. There’s even a cute new doctor in town that has caught the eyes of everyone, Eva included. But when her best friend, Maddy, asks Eva to join forces with her brother for the sake of her upcoming wedding, Eva’s quaint life is upended. Cold and rigid, Aston is the man who broke Eva’s heart back in high school. He’s also one of the country’s hottest billionaires.
With both Aston and Eva trying to outdo each other and stake claim as Maddy’s right hand man, the competition heats up. But as their annoyance grows, so does their attraction, and when they share a kiss, everything changes. Suddenly, Eva isn’t so sure about where she stands with Aston. And with Maddy’s wedding fast approaching, their time together is dwindling until Aston returns to his life in New York.
Will Eva survive this wedding with her heart intact? Or is she setting herself up for heartbreak again?”
